[PATCH 33/66] drm/amdgpu: add initial IP discovery support for vega based parts

Alex Deucher alexdeucher at gmail.com
Wed Sep 22 15:58:31 UTC 2021


On Wed, Sep 22, 2021 at 3:54 AM Lazar, Lijo <lijo.lazar at amd.com> wrote:
>
>
>
> On 9/21/2021 11:36 PM, Alex Deucher wrote:
> > Hardcode the IP versions for asics without IP discovery tables
> > and then enumerate the asics based on the IP versions.
> >
> > TODO: fix SR-IOV support
> >
> > Signed-off-by: Alex Deucher <alexander.deucher at amd.com>

>
> Just found that this version is shared with VG20. Since it's a soft IP
> version table anyway, any problem in changing to say 11.0.3 and avoid
> ASIC checks?

I thought about that, but wanted to stay consistent with the hw
versions documented internally.

Alex
